There was a time when orthodontics or getting braces was considered to be fit only for children. It was believed that teeth can be corrected only up to a certain age after which they more or less get fixed and can be extremely difficult to alter. Another concern was that braces would be visible thereby embarrassing adults for a very long period of time. However, with the various technological advancements, adult orthodontics has gone on to become extremely popular in almost all corners of the world. Now days, more and more adults are going for orthodontic treatment as it helps in correcting the position and shape of their teeth and jaw and helps make them more confident in their day-to-day lives.

However, the truth is that adult orthodontics is relatively complex and can pose a number of problems primarily as the teeth are non-growing thereby reducing the scope of treatment. Modification due to growth is not possible and any skeletal discrepancy needs to be corrected with a surgery or accepted. As the vertical condylar is not growing, the correction of overbite becomes extremely challenging. Moreover, periodontal diseases and loss of attachment becomes more common with age thereby making adult orthodontics even more difficult.
The most common misconception is that orthodontics is a branch of dentistry that is only successful when treatment is done at a young age. Though this is true to an extent and treatment is quicker in case of young children, but adult orthodontics is also equally successful. A number of people do not get braces at a young age and over the years feel the need to correct the position and shape of teeth and jaws. However, there is also a silver lining to adult orthodontics. Once grown up people decide to undergo orthodontic treatment, they are more sincere and follow all that the doctor instructions more closely thereby improving the chances of success of the treatment.
